4 Exhibit A to Ordinance No. <br />Central Waterfront Redevelopment Plan <br />• City's downtown redevelopment strategy to promote a mix of commercial and residential <br />1-1 <br />uses in the central business district <br />• corrununity's interest in providing a physical connection to the water's edge <br />• community's interest in encouraging family wage jobs in Everett <br />• potential to incorporate public access, either on-site or in other off-site locations to <br />improve the conununity's access to the shoreline. <br />• the comprehensive plan industrial land preservation policy <br />The four land use alternatives considered were: <br />1. Existing Regulations — No Action Alternative. Land Use Vision for Existing M-2 zoned <br />areas_ No change to existing regulations. All existing M-2 zone uses are permitted. <br />0.Permitted uses in the shoreline area included water -dependent and water -related industrial <br />uses, water -oriented commercial uses, recreational uses, boating facilities, transportation <br />facilities, and utilities and utility facilities. Outside of shoreline areas (200 feet from <br />Ordinary High Water Mark), a wide variety of uses are permitted. No changes to existing <br />development standards or review processes. No additional restrictions on uses or <br />development standards. <br />Public Access Concept - Not required on-site unless a non -water -dependent use is established <br />in shoreline jurisdiction. Off-site public access to the shoreline may be substituted in lieu of <br />on-site public access. <br />Land Use Vision for Properties located east of West Marine View Drive — No change to <br />existing zoning. The existing R -3H, R-5 and B-1 zone regulations would not change. <br />2. Water -Dependent and Heavy Industrial. Land Use Vision for Existing M-2 zoned areas — A <br />working waterfront job center including cargo handling, water -dependent manufacturing <br />supported by railroad access, marine services, marine commerce and construction, and Naval <br />Station Everett operations, all supporting a strong regional economy. Would include <br />revisions to permitted M-2 uses, requiring water -dependent / related industrial uses and <br />prohibiting or lirniting non -industrial uses to those that serve industrial uses in the area, and <br />water -oriented uses. Would add development standards to prohibit or mitigate off-site <br />impacts related to noise, odor, aesthetics, air quality, and other impacts. <br />Public Access Concept - Not required on-site unless a non -water -dependent use is established <br />in shoreline jurisdiction. Off-site public access to the shoreline may be substituted in lieu of <br />on-site public access. <br />10 <br />
